> A Sortable is a special case combination of a Draggable and a  
> Droppable. A Sortable may be dragged into another Sortable as long as  
> both lists include the other in their "containment" property. But  
> there is no equivalent to Draggable's revert in a Sortable.
>
> In my work, I found that while you could drop a draggable onto a  
> sortable, you couldn't get the dropped element to join the sortable  
> explicitly. I took a run up this mountain a couple of months ago, and  
> the best I was able to do was to make a set of draggables, wrap the  
> sortable in a parent which I made droppable, and set revert to true on  
> those draggables. On a successful drop, I would generate a new  
> element, insert it into the sortable, re-initialize the sortable, and  
> then the user would need to drag the new element into position within  
> the list.
>
> What WLQ would like (what I would like, too) is something more direct.  
> A set of draggable options that can be dragged into a sortable, revert  
> back to their parent, and leave a clone behind in the position within  
> the list where they were dropped. This is not possible as far as I've  
> been able to do it.
>
> Getting the unique ID either from Prototype or MySQL is trivial, and  
> not really the actual problem here.
